https://bugs.gentoo.org/852884 From: orbea Date: Sat, 18 Jun 2022 10:00:21 -0700 Subject: [PATCH] configure: Set version directly in AC_INIT This avoids a command not found error in config.status. --- a/Makefile.in +++ b/Makefile.in @@ -20,7 +20,7 @@ # Add a _letter_ if you change the version number and release your own version. # Numbers are for the original author(s) only. -DICT_VERSION=@DICT_VERSION@ +DICT_VERSION=@PACKAGE_VERSION@ ifneq (,) This makefile requires GNU Make. --- a/configure.in +++ b/configure.in @@ -23,14 +23,10 @@ dnl CFLAGS and LDFLAGS should be settable on the make commandline dnl for optimization and stripping. dnl LIBOBJS is an automatically-generated list of extra objects we need - -define(VERSION, 1.13.0) - - AC_PREREQ(2.53) AC_REVISION($Revision: 1.144 $) -AC_INIT([dict],[VERSION],[dict-beta@dict.org]) +AC_INIT([dict],[1.13.0],[dict-beta@dict.org]) AC_CONFIG_SRCDIR([dictd.c]) AC_CONFIG_HEADER(config.h) @@ -40,8 +36,6 @@ LT_INIT echo Configuring for dict echo . -DICT_VERSION=VERSION - AC_CANONICAL_HOST AC_PROG_CC @@ -183,7 +177,6 @@ SBINDIR=`eval3 $sbindir` LIBEXECDIR=`eval3 $libexecdir` DATADIR=`eval3 $datadir` -AC_SUBST(DICT_VERSION) AC_SUBST(USE_PLUGIN) AC_SUBST(EXEEXT) AC_SUBST(allsubdirs) --- a/dictdplugin-config.in +++ b/dictdplugin-config.in @@ -24,7 +24,7 @@ while test $# -ne 0; do usage exit;; --version) - echo @DICT_VERSION@ + echo @PACKAGE_VERSION@ exit;; --libs) echo -L@libdir@